1 In the beginning was the Word, and the Word was with God, and the Word was God.
Ní àtètèkọ́ṣe ni Ọ̀rọ̀ wà, Ọ̀rọ̀ sì wà pẹ̀lú Ọlọ́run, Ọlọ́run sì ni Ọ̀rọ̀ náà.
2 The same was in the beginning with God.
Òun ni ó sì wà pẹ̀lú Ọlọ́run ní àtètèkọ́ṣe.
3 All things were made through him; and without him was nothing made that hath been made.
Nípasẹ̀ rẹ̀ ni a dá ohun gbogbo; lẹ́yìn rẹ̀ a kò sì dá ohun kan nínú ohun tí a ti dá.
4 In him is life; and the life was the light of men.
Nínú rẹ̀ ni ìyè wà, ìyè yìí náà sì ni ìmọ́lẹ̀ aráyé,
5 And the light hath been shining in the darkness; and the darkness received it not.
ìmọ́lẹ̀ náà sì ń mọ́lẹ̀ nínú òkùnkùn, òkùnkùn kò sì borí rẹ̀.
6 There was a man, sent from God, whose name was John.
Ọkùnrin kan wà tí a rán láti ọ̀dọ̀ Ọlọ́run wá; orúkọ ẹni tí ń jẹ́ Johanu.
7 He came as a witness, to bear witness of the light, that through him all might believe.
Òun ni a sì rán fún ẹ̀rí, kí ó lè ṣe ẹlẹ́rìí fún ìmọ́lẹ̀ náà, kí gbogbo ènìyàn kí ó lè gbàgbọ́ nípasẹ̀ rẹ̀.
8 He was not the light, but came to bear witness of the light.
Òun fúnra rẹ̀ kì í ṣe ìmọ́lẹ̀ náà, ṣùgbọ́n a rán an wá láti ṣe ẹlẹ́rìí fún ìmọ́lẹ̀ náà.
9 The true light, which enlighteneth every man, was coming into the world.
Ìmọ́lẹ̀ òtítọ́ ń bẹ tí ń tan ìmọ́lẹ̀ fún olúkúlùkù ènìyàn tí ó wá sí ayé.
10 He was in the world, and the world was made through him, and the world knew him not.
Òun sì wà ní ayé, àti pé, nípasẹ̀ rẹ̀ ni a sì ti dá ayé, ṣùgbọ́n ayé kò sì mọ̀ ọ́n.
11 He came to his own, and his own received him not.
Ó tọ àwọn tirẹ̀ wá, àwọn tirẹ̀ kò sì gbà á.
12 But as many as received him, to them he gave power to become children of God, —to those who believed in his name;
Ṣùgbọ́n iye àwọn tí ó gbà á, àní àwọn náà tí ó gbà orúkọ rẹ̀ gbọ́, àwọn ni ó fi ẹ̀tọ́ fún láti di ọmọ Ọlọ́run.
13 who were born, not of blood, nor of the will of the flesh, nor of the will of man, but of God.
Àwọn ọmọ tí kì í ṣe nípa ẹ̀jẹ̀, tàbí nípa ti ìfẹ́ ara, bẹ́ẹ̀ ni kì í ṣe nípa ìfẹ́ ti ènìyàn, bí kò ṣe láti ọwọ́ Ọlọ́run.
14 And the Word became flesh, and dwelt among us, full of grace and truth; and we beheld his glory, a glory as of an only begotten of a father.
Ọ̀rọ̀ náà sì di ara, òun sì ń bá wa gbé. Àwa sì ti rí ògo rẹ̀, àní ògo ọmọ rẹ kan ṣoṣo, tí ó ti ọ̀dọ̀ Baba wá, ó kún fún oore-ọ̀fẹ́ àti òtítọ́.
15 John beareth witness of him, and crieth, saying, This was he of whom I said, He that cometh after me hath gone before me; for he was before me.
Johanu sì jẹ́rìí nípa rẹ̀, ó kígbe, ó sì wí pé, “Èyí ni ẹni tí mo sọ̀rọ̀ rẹ̀ pé, ‘Ẹni tí ń bọ̀ lẹ́yìn mi pọ̀jù mí lọ, nítorí òun ti wà ṣáájú mi.’”
16 For out of his fullness have we all received, and grace upon grace.
Nítorí láti inú ẹ̀kúnrẹ́rẹ́ oore-ọ̀fẹ́ rẹ̀ ni gbogbo wa sì ti gba ìbùkún kún ìbùkún.
17 For the Law was given through Moses; grace and truth came through Jesus Christ.
Nítorí pé nípasẹ̀ Mose ni a ti fi òfin fún ni ṣùgbọ́n òun; oore-ọ̀fẹ́ àti òtítọ́ láti ipasẹ̀ Jesu Kristi wá.
18 No one hath ever seen God; the only begotten God, who is in the bosom of the Father, he hath made him known.
Kò sí ẹni tí ó rí Ọlọ́run rí, bí kò ṣe òun nìkan, àní ọmọ rẹ̀ kan ṣoṣo, ẹni tí òun pàápàá jẹ́ Ọlọ́run, tí ó sì wà ní ìbáṣepọ̀ tí ó súnmọ́ jùlọ pẹ̀lú baba, òun náà ni ó sì fi í hàn.
19 And this is the witness of John, when the Jews sent priests and Levites from Jerusalem, to ask him, Who art thou?
Èyí sì ni ẹ̀rí Johanu, nígbà tí àwọn Júù rán àwọn àlùfáà àti àwọn ọmọ Lefi láti Jerusalẹmu wá láti béèrè lọ́wọ́ rẹ̀ ẹni tí òun ń ṣe.
20 And he declared, and did not deny; and he declared, I am not the Christ.
Òun kò sì kùnà láti jẹ́wọ́, ṣùgbọ́n òun jẹ́wọ́ wọ́ọ́rọ́wọ́ pé, “Èmi kì í ṣe Kristi náà.”
21 And they asked him, What then? Art thou Elijah? And he said, I am not. Art thou the prophet? And he answered, No.
Wọ́n sì bi í léèrè pé, “Ta ha ni ìwọ? Elijah ni ìwọ bí?” Ó sì wí pé, “Èmi kọ́.” “Ìwọ ni wòlíì náà bí?” Ó sì dáhùn pé, “Bẹ́ẹ̀ kọ́.”
22 They said therefore to him, Who art thou? that we may give an answer to those who sent us; what sayest thou of thyself?
Ní ìparí wọ́n wí fún un pé, “Ta ni ìwọ í ṣe? Fún wa ní ìdáhùn kí àwa kí ó lè mú èsì padà tọ àwọn tí ó rán wa wá lọ. Kí ni ìwọ wí nípa ti ara rẹ?”
23 He said, I am “a voice of one crying aloud in the wilderness, Make straight the way of the Lord,” as said Isaiah the prophet.
Johanu sì fi ọ̀rọ̀ wòlíì Isaiah fún wọn ní èsì pé, “Èmi ni ohùn ẹni tí ń kígbe ní ijù, ‘Ẹ ṣe ọ̀nà Olúwa ní títọ́.’”
24 And they were sent from the Pharisees;
Ọ̀kan nínú àwọn Farisi tí a rán
25 and they asked him and said to him, Why then dost thou baptize, if thou art not the Christ, nor Elijah, nor the prophet?
bi í léèrè pé, “Èéṣe tí ìwọ fi ń bamitiisi nígbà náà, bí ìwọ kì í bá ṣe Kristi, tàbí Elijah, tàbí wòlíì náà?”
26 John answered them, saying, I baptize in water. There standeth one among you whom ye know not,
Johanu dá wọn lóhùn, wí pé, “Èmi ń fi omi bamitiisi, ẹnìkan dúró láàrín yín, ẹni tí ẹ̀yin kò mọ̀,
27 he who cometh after me, the latchet of whose sandal I am not worthy to loose.
Òun náà ni ẹni tí ń bọ̀ lẹ́yìn mi, okùn bàtà ẹni tí èmi kò tó láti tú.”
28 These things took place in Bethany beyond the Jordan, where John was baptizing.
Àwọn nǹkan wọ̀nyí ni ó ṣẹlẹ̀ ní Betani ní òdìkejì odò Jordani, níbi tí Johanu ti ń fi omi bamitiisi.
29 The next day he seeth Jesus coming to him, and saith, Behold, the Lamb of God, who taketh away the sin of the world!
Ní ọjọ́ kejì, Johanu rí Jesu tí ó ń bọ̀ wá sí ọ̀dọ̀ rẹ̀, ó sì wí pé, “Wò ó, Ọ̀dọ́-àgùntàn Ọlọ́run, ẹni tí ó kó ẹ̀ṣẹ̀ ayé lọ!
30 This is he of whom I said, After me cometh a man, who hath gone before me; for he was before me.
Èyí ni ẹni tí mo ń sọ nígbà tí mo wí pé, ‘Ọkùnrin kan tí ń bọ̀ wá lẹ́yìn mi, tí ó pọ̀jù mí lọ, nítorí tí ó ti wà ṣáájú mi.’
31 And I knew him not; but that he might be made manifest to Israel, therefore I came baptizing in water.
Èmi gan an kò sì mọ̀ ọ́n, ṣùgbọ́n ìdí tí mo fi wá ń fi omi ṣe ìtẹ̀bọmi ni kí a lè fi í hàn fún Israẹli.”
32 And John bore witness, saying, I have seen the Spirit descending as a dove from heaven, and it abode upon him.
Nígbà náà ni Johanu jẹ́rìí sí i pé, “Mo rí Ẹ̀mí sọ̀kalẹ̀ láti ọ̀run wá bí àdàbà, tí ó sì bà lé e.
33 And I knew him not; but he who sent me to baptize in water, the same said to me, Upon whom thou shalt see the Spirit descending and abiding on him, he it is that baptizeth in the Holy Spirit.
Èmi kì bá tí mọ̀ ọ́n, bí kò ṣe pé ẹni tí ó rán mi láti fi omi bamitiisi sọ fún mi pé, ‘Ọkùnrin tí ìwọ rí tí Ẹ̀mí sọ̀kalẹ̀ tí ó bà lé lórí ni ẹni tí yóò fi Ẹ̀mí Mímọ́ bamitiisi.’
34 And I have seen and have borne witness, that this is the Son of God.
Èmi ti rí i, mo sì jẹ́rìí pé, èyí ni Ọmọ Ọlọ́run.”
35 On the morrow John was again standing, and two of his disciples;
Ní ọjọ́ kejì, Johanu dúró pẹ̀lú méjì nínú àwọn ọmọ-ẹ̀yìn rẹ̀.
36 and looking upon Jesus as he was walking, he saith, Behold, the Lamb of God!
Nígbà tí ó sì rí Jesu bí ó ti ń kọjá lọ, ó wí pé, “Wò ó Ọ̀dọ́-àgùntàn Ọlọ́run!”
37 The two disciples heard him speaking, and they followed Jesus.
Nígbà tí àwọn ọmọ-ẹ̀yìn méjì náà sì gbọ́ ohun tí ó wí yìí, wọ́n bẹ̀rẹ̀ sì í tọ Jesu lẹ́yìn.
38 Jesus turning and seeing them following, saith to them, What seek ye? And they said to him, Rabbi, (that is to say, when interpreted, Teacher, ) where dost thou dwell?
Nígbà náà ni Jesu yípadà, ó rí i pé wọ́n ń tọ òun lẹ́yìn, ó sì béèrè pé, “Kí ni ẹ̀yin ń wá?” Wọ́n wí fún un pé, “Rabbi” (ìtumọ̀ èyí tí í ṣe Olùkọ́ni), “Níbo ni ìwọ ń gbé?”
39 He saith to them, Come, and ye shall see. They came therefore and saw where he dwelt; and they abode with him that day. It was about the tenth hour.
Ó wí fún wọn pé, “Ẹ wá wò ó, ẹ̀yin yóò sì rí i.” Wọ́n sì wá, wọ́n sì rí ibi tí ó ń gbé, wọ́n sì wà ní ọ̀dọ̀ rẹ̀ ní gbogbo ọjọ́ náà. Ó jẹ́ ìwọ̀n wákàtí kẹwàá ọjọ́.
40 One of the two who heard what John said, and followed him, was Andrew, Simon Peter's brother.
Anderu arákùnrin Simoni Peteru jẹ́ ọ̀kan nínú àwọn méjì tí ó gbọ́ ọ̀rọ̀ Johanu, tí ó sì tọ Jesu lẹ́yìn.
41 He first findeth his own brother Simon, and saith to him, We have found the Messiah; (which is, when interpreted, the Christ.)
Ohun àkọ́kọ́ tí Anderu ṣe ni láti wá Simoni arákùnrin rẹ̀, ó sì wí fún un pé, “Àwa ti rí Messia” (ẹni tí ṣe Kristi).
42 He brought him to Jesus. Jesus looking upon him said, Thou art Simon, the son of John; thou shalt be called Cephas; (which signifieth Peter, that is, Rock.)
Ó sì mú un wá sọ́dọ̀ Jesu. Jesu sì wò ó, ó wí pé, “Ìwọ ni Simoni ọmọ Jona: Kefa ni a ó sì máa pè ọ” (ìtumọ̀ èyí tí ṣe Peteru).
43 On the morrow he determined to go forth into Galilee, and findeth Philip. And Jesus saith to him, Follow me.
Ní ọjọ́ kejì Jesu ń fẹ́ jáde lọ sí Galili, ó sì rí Filipi, ó sì wí fún un pé, “Máa tọ̀ mí lẹ́yìn.”
44 Now Philip was of Bethsaida, the city of Andrew and Peter.
Filipi gẹ́gẹ́ bí i Anderu àti Peteru, jẹ́ ará ìlú Betisaida.
45 Philip findeth Nathanael, and saith to him, We have found him of whom Moses in the Law, and the Prophets wrote, Jesus, the son of Joseph, who is of Nazareth.
Filipi rí Natanaeli, ó sì wí fún un pé, “Àwa ti rí ẹni náà tí Mose kọ nípa rẹ̀ nínú òfin àti ẹni tí àwọn wòlíì ti kọ̀wé rẹ̀, Jesu ti Nasareti, ọmọ Josẹfu.”
46 And Nathanael said to him, Can any good thing come out of Nazareth? Philip saith to him, Come and see.
Natanaeli béèrè pé, “Nasareti? Ohun rere kan ha lè ti ibẹ̀ jáde?” Filipi wí fún un pé, “Wá wò ó.”
47 Jesus saw Nathanael coming to him, and saith of him, Behold an Israelite indeed, in whom is no guile.
Jesu rí Natanaeli ń bọ̀ wá sọ́dọ̀ rẹ̀, ó sì wí nípa rẹ̀ pé, “Èyí ni ọmọ Israẹli tòótọ́, nínú ẹni tí ẹ̀tàn kò sí.”
48 Nathanael saith to him, Whence dost thou know me? Jesus answered and said to him, Before Philip called thee, when thou wast under the fig-tree, I saw thee.
Natanaeli béèrè pé, “Báwo ni ìwọ ti ṣe mọ̀ mí?” Jesu sì dáhùn pé, “Èmi rí ọ nígbà tí ìwọ wà lábẹ́ igi ọ̀pọ̀tọ́ kí Filipi tó pè ọ́.”
49 Nathanael answered him, Rabbi, thou art the Son of God, thou art the king of Israel.
Nígbà náà ni Natanaeli sọ ọ́ gbangba pé, “Rabbi, ìwọ ni Ọmọ Ọlọ́run; Ìwọ ni ọba Israẹli.”
50 Jesus answered and said to him, Because I said to thee, I saw thee under the fig-tree, dost thou believe? Thou shalt see greater things than these.
Jesu sì wí fún un pé, “Ìwọ gbàgbọ́ nítorí mo wí fún ọ pé mo rí ọ lábẹ́ igi ọ̀pọ̀tọ́. Ìwọ ó rí ohun tí ó pọ̀jù ìwọ̀nyí lọ.”
51 And he saith to him, Truly, truly do I say to you, Ye will see heaven opened, and the angels of God ascending and descending upon the Son of man.
Nígbà náà ni ó fi kún un pé, “Èmi wí fún yín nítòótọ́, ẹ̀yin yóò rí ọ̀run ṣí sílẹ̀, àwọn angẹli Ọlọ́run yóò sì máa gòkè, wọ́n ó sì máa sọ̀kalẹ̀ sórí Ọmọ Ènìyàn.”
